DG Unlimited is a founding partner of the Dumfries and Galloway Cultural Partnership. We are proud to work with Dumfries and Galloway’s strategic public partners, Dumfries and Galloway Council and South of Scotland Enterprise, and with key regional organisations like the Museums and Heritage Network, major events and festival in our region and a variety cultural and creative organisations to advocate for the vital role creative practitioners of all mediums play in our communities, economy and cultural life.

First and foremost we are a membership organisation with a focus on inclusivity, collaboration, development, and support. Our core principles are to be open, welcoming, inclusive and reactive to the needs of our members. DG Unlimited is an active and contributing member of ‘Scotland’s Creative Networks’ the national collective of Scotland wide creative networks and organisations, we met during the year to share updates, develop ideas, collaborate and to engage with our sister networks as we all champion the creative and cultural sector in Scotland.
As a membership-led organisation we are dedicated to supporting creative and cultural individuals and organisations across Dumfries and Galloway. We advocate for their needs, foster collaboration, and provide a variety of development opportunities, creative professional development, funding, advice, sign-posting, and individual support services.
